What a great day for a trial ride! There was just three rigs, two full size Fords and myself the lone Jeeper.. Fun trail with mud holes, small hill climbs, and two big holes with by-passes, a few water crossings and one tunnel which was cool. Saw some other Jeepers while we were playing. All in all a fun ride, will likely go back in a few weeks.

Its a big hole...very rutted and should be real fun with all the rain last night. Anyway not sure how to tell you to get there from Roanoke, but if you know where Rt 130 is and the public boat launch (the last one before the dam) the road to the trail is right next to the boat launch. The Appalachian trail goes right through there too.
Go up the road about 2 miles maybe and the trail head is on the right. When you leave the trail at the end, take a right and that will take you back to Rt 130 take a right to go home...
